jQuery is a commonly used JavaScript library used to simplify the operation, processing and event registration of HTML documents. In web design, the scroll view is a very important element, which can slide different elements on the page to better display the content. In jQuery, such a view can be easily created using the scrollview plugin. This article will introduce how to use the scrollview plug-in with jQuery.

1. What is scrollview?

ScrollView is a plug-in in jQuery Mobile that allows the display of an entire content within a fixed area and enables horizontal and vertical scrolling operations. It can be used as a container to accommodate other elements, so it can replace the traditional frame framework.

2. Examples of using scrollview

The following is a simple code example for using scrollview to display images:

<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
    <title>使用ScrollView</title>
    <meta charset="utf-8">
    <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1">
    <link rel="stylesheet" href="https://cdn.bootcss.com/jquery-mobile/1.4.5/jquery.mobile.min.css">
    <script src="https://cdn.bootcss.com/jquery/1.12.4/jquery.min.js"></script>
    <script src="https://cdn.bootcss.com/jquery-mobile/1.4.5/jquery.mobile.min.js"></script>
</head>
<body>

<div data-role="page">
    <div data-role="header">
        <h1 id="ScrollView示例">ScrollView示例</h1>
    </div>
    <div data-role="content">
        <div id="wrapper">
            <div id="scroller">
                <ul data-role="listview">
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="1.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="2.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="3.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="4.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="5.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="6.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="7.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                    <li><img  src="/static/imghwm/default1.png"  data-src="8.png"  class="lazy" alt="How to use scrollview with jquery" ></li>
                </ul>
            </div>
        </div>
    </div>
    <div data-role="footer">
        <h4 id="footer">footer</h4>
    </div>
</div>

<script type="text/javascript">
    $(function(){
        $("#wrapper").css("height",($(window).height()-62)+"px");
        var myScroll = new IScroll('#wrapper', { mouseWheel: true });
    });
</script>

</body>
</html>

The above code uses three library files: jQuery, jQuery Mobile and iScroll. Among them, iScroll is a JavaScript library that provides customizable scroll bars that can be scrolled through gestures, scroll wheels, etc.

In the html file, the jQuery and jQuery Mobile libraries are first introduced. Then, use the data-role attribute to assign specific roles to elements in the page, such as header, content, footer, etc. In this example, the header places a title, and the content places an element with the id of wrapper, which contains an element with the id of scroller, which contains an unordered list based on the listview. Finally, footer places a footer.

In the javascript code, the height is set for the wrapper element through the css method, and an instance is created through IScroll. The myScroll object here can be used to manage sliding.

3. Scrollview implementation principle

To understand the implementation process of scrollview, you need to understand its basic principles. It takes a fixed-size container and embeds a large scrollable area within the container. In this way, the size of the container acts as a window and only displays a part of the scrollable area, while the sliding operation changes the position of the scrollable area in the container, ultimately realizing the sliding of the view.

4. Common problems and solutions of scrollview

When using scrollview, you may encounter some common problems, especially the compatibility issues with different browsers, devices and operating systems. . The following are some solutions:

  1. Compatibility issues: It is strongly recommended to use jQuery Mobile version 1.4.5 or above library files;
  2. Container size issues: The size of the container should be based on different Dynamic adjustment of the device;
  3. Container nesting problem: other scrollable elements should not appear in the container;
  4. Scroll bar problem: When using iScroll, you can adjust the scroll bar through the iScroll option Make settings.
